Hi all,

I have asthma, and it is not too severe, but unfortunatly stress is a big trigger for my asthma, and i stress out all the time.
I have an oppertunity to travel to mexico for free with my boyfriend and his family. This trip is very important to him, and me as well. But i am very nurvous because of the humid climate.
Has anyone travelled into humid areas such as mexico with asthma?

This is a big stress on my life, and before i got asthma ( a year ago) i loved travelling , expecially to hot and humid climates. Now i am scared to death of travelling out of Canada.
Especially Los Angeles, ( i love la, tons of my family lives there)
but i know because of the pollution it could be a big problem.

I am also Canadian, so i dont know the hospital systems in the united states and mexico.
If i had an asthma attack, what would happen? If i had to go to the hospital, would they evan treat me? and if i did, would i be leaving with a heafty hospital bill?

Im also wondering about about airplanes. Anyone out there travelled on a airplane, with asthma, and had a asthma attack? What could i do? Nothing i think. But any one that could put my fears to rest would be great. I know things can always happen, and i cant controll everything, but these are legitamite things to wonder i think. So i want to know as much info as possible.

Is it possible to get travellers health insurence for pre existing health problems???

Any help at all would be very very muchly appriciated.
